predict the number of each atom needed to form a molecule of potassium Sulfide.

Respuesta :

superman1987
superman1987 superman1987
  • 10-03-2019

Answer:

2.0 atoms of K and 1.0 atom of S are needed to form a molecule of potassium sulfide.

Explanation:

  • The potassium sulfide has the chemical formula K₂S.

∴ Every 1.0 molecule of K₂S composed of 2.0 atom of K and 1.0 atoms of S.

So, 2.0 atoms of K and 1.0 atom of S are needed to form a molecule of potassium sulfide.
